CHEMISTRY -
  • the study of the structure and composition of
    matter, the physical and chemical changes it
    undergoes and the energy that is exchanged.

2
?
  • structure is the order in which the atoms are
    actually hooked together and how they bond
  • composition is what kinds of elements actually
    make-up something
  • Matter is the physical "stuff" of the universe.
    It is defined as anything which has mass and
    occupies space.
  • Law of Conservation of Matter Matter can neither
    be created nor destroyed only changed by physical
    or chemical means.

Homogeneous Matter homogeneous means that it is
one phase throughout completely uniform ex
water
  • ELEMENT - matter composed of only one type of
    atom the simplest form of matter cannot be
    changed to another element except by a NUCLEAR
    reaction
  • 112 have been discovered but only 109 have been
    named and their names accepted only 88 elements
    are naturally occurring all others are man made
  • the symbol for an element is 1 capital letter OR
    1 capital letter and 1 lower-case letter.
  • Some elements are named by their English
  • names the element Carbon is symbolized by its
  • English name Carbon C
  • Some are named by their Latin names
  • Ex The element Sodium is symbolized
  • by its Latin name Natrium Na

4
Homogeneous matter
  • COMPOUNDS are substances composed of more than
    one atom chemically joined together
  • compounds can be changed to other compounds and
    separated by chemical reactions only cannot be
    physically separated.
  • compounds do not have the same properties of the
    elements which make them up. EX H2O
  • the chemical formula for a compound will have
    more than 1 capital letter in it because it
    contains more than one element, Ex C12H22O22
  • the proportions of elements in a compound do not
    change or you have changed the compound. For
    example H2O vs H2O2

Homogeneous Solutions
  • SOLUTIONS are a uniform mix of two or more
    substances which are NOT chemically bonded and
    therefore, unlike compounds, each component
    retains its original identity and properties, you
    cannot see the particles of these two substances
    and thus a solution allows the transmittance of
    light.
  • A solution has TWO parts--
  • SOLUTE is the component which whose phase is
    changed. ONLY if both components are the same
    phase, the solute is the one in the LESSER
    quantity For example Sugar and water
  • SOLVENT is the component which remains unchanged.
  • ONLY if both components are the same phase, the
    solvent
  • is the one in the GREATER quantity.
  • When two liquids are mixed, we describe their
    interaction as
  • MISCIBLE If they dissolve in each other
    completely and
  • mix uniformly in any proportions An example of
    miscible
  • liquids is vinegar and water.
  • IMMISCIBLE If the two liquids do not dissolve in
    each other
  • and form two distinct layers, they are said to
    be Examples of immiscible liquids are oil and
    water.
  • Alloy When two metals are melted together, like
    gold and silver to make jewelry

Heterogeneous Matter HETEROGENEOUS SUBSTANCES
ARE ALWAYS MIXTURES! They are not uniform in
composition. There is more than one phase
present
  • Dry Heterogeneous Mixtures made of dry
    particles of different types can be elements
    and/or compounds.
  • If a solution has particles in it, it is not
    technically called a solution anymore. There are
    two ways we name these types of heterogeneous
    mixtures
  • Colloid a mixture whos particles are
  • evenly distributed and bigger than the
  • particles in a solution but smaller than
  • the particles in a suspension
  • Suspension a mixture whos particles are so
    large that they settle out unless constantly
    agitated.
